Analyzing User Behavior for Optimal App Design
To craft compelling and successful applications, developers must delve into the intricate world of user behavior. By analyzing how users utilize your app, you can uncover valuable insights that guide design decisions. Through careful monitoring of user actions, such as screen navigation, interaction frequency, and completion rates, designers can acquire a comprehensive understanding of user needs and preferences. This understanding is crucial for improving the app experience, making it more accessible.
- Leveraging A/B testing allows developers to compare different design variations and determine the most impactful solution.
- Feedback from users can provide invaluable information into their experiences with the app.
Mastering the Art of Cross-Platform Development
In today's rapidly evolving technological landscape, programmers are constantly pursuing to create applications that can reach a wide audience. This is where cross-platform development comes into play, providing a check here powerful avenue for building software that seamlessly operates across multiple operating systems.
- Utilizing the right tools and technologies is crucial for successful cross-platform development.
- Leading frameworks such as React Native and Flutter enable developers to craft native-like experiences on diverse platforms.
- Thorough understanding of different operating systems and their specificities is essential.
By mastering the art of cross-platform development, developers can enhance their reach, improve development workflows, and ultimately create exceptional user experiences across a global user pool.

App Development Evolution
From humble beginnings with basic functionality to sophisticated platforms leveraging cutting-edge technologies, mobile app development has undergone a profound transformation. The initial wave focused on basic applications, often serving as utilities for tasks like phone calls and text messaging. As technology evolved, apps expanded in complexity, incorporating functionalities such as location services and internet connectivity. Such evolution marked a new era of mobile interactions, enabling developers to create apps that catered a wide range of user needs and interests.
